The Japanese Dragon and Oni Mask tattoo idea beautifully combines the ethereal power of the dragon, a symbol of strength and wisdom, with the ferociousness and complexity of the Oni mask, representing the darker aspects of human nature and cultural mythology, This striking juxtaposition captures the essence of the duality present in life itself, exploring themes of good versus evil, protection, and inner conflict, The tattoo typically features an elegantly rendered Japanese dragon, coiling and swirling through clouds or waves, juxtaposed against a vividly illustrated Oni mask, its exaggerated features expressing fierce emotions that evoke power and a warning, encapsulating a rich narrative tied to Japan's historical folklore, This unique blend sets the stage for a captivating and culturally rich tattoo that resonates deeply among collectors and enthusiasts alike, The origins of this tattoo concept can be traced back to Japan’s ancient traditions, where dragons were revered as wise guardians associated with water, agriculture, and balance in nature, Meanwhile, Oni masks depict the spirits of demons and supernatural beings within Japanese folklore, Used in traditional theater and festivals, these masks convey powerful emotions and lessons, reflecting the culture’s regard for the undercurrents of good and evil that pervade human life, The amalgamation of these two symbols in Japanese Dragon and Oni Mask tattoos not only tells a story of balance but also serves as a testament to the intricate artistry of Japanese tattooing, known as Irezumi, The meaning and symbolism of this tattoo idea are profound, The dragon represents strength, protection, and the triumph of wisdom over brute force, while the Oni mask symbolizes the complexity of humanity—the shadowy parts we all wrestle with, Together, they remind the bearer of their inner strength and the importance of embracing both light and dark aspects of the self, In a spiritual sense, this tattoo idea serves as a powerful talisman, offering protection and guidance, while also acknowledging the importance of personal growth through confronting one's fears and darker thoughts, For those interested in Japanese Dragon and Oni Mask tattoo ideas, popular styles that suit this concept include traditional Japanese tattooing, neo-traditional, and black and grey styles, Traditional Japanese techniques highlight vibrant colors, intricate patterns, and flowing designs that complement the dynamic nature of the dragon and the detailed features of the Oni mask.
Alternatively, the neo-traditional style allows for more modern interpretations, maintaining bold lines and vivid colors while integrating a storytelling aspect that gives the tattoo depth, Black and grey can create a timeless look, emphasizing shadows and highlights that enhance the drama of the imagery, The best placements for a Japanese Dragon and Oni Mask tattoo idea would be on larger canvas areas of the body such as the back, chest, or sleeve, These surfaces provide ample room for the detail that both the dragon and the Oni mask deserve, allowing the artist to create a flowing composition that engages the viewer, A sleeve would wrap beautifully around the arm, where the dragon’s body could extend and coil, with the Oni mask as a focal point, telling a cohesive story as it transitions along the limb, Variations and creative adaptations of the Japanese Dragon and Oni Mask tattoos abound, Artists can play with color schemes, detailed backgrounds, or even incorporate waves, cherry blossoms, or temple elements to enrich the design’s cultural narrative, Some choose to blend the dragon and mask into a more abstract or modern art style, allowing for personal expression that resonates with their journey, Others might opt for a minimalist interpretation, focusing on the contours of the mask or the dragon’s silhouette, creating an understated but impactful piece, In summary, the Japanese Dragon and Oni Mask tattoo idea serves as not only a rich expression of artistry but also a deep contemplation of the duality of existence, With a blend of historical significance and personal meaning, this tattoo resonates with many, making it a fantastic choice for those exploring tattoo ideas that encapsulate the essence of their life’s journey, Whether you lean towards traditional styles or prefer a modern twist, exploring the diverse options available allows for a unique tribute to culturally significant symbolism.
